Mechanism of Action
  • 1 Cellular Signaling: GHK-Cu participates in cellular signaling pathways, modulating gene expression related to skin repair and regeneration.
  • 2 Fibroblast Activation & ECM Synthesis: Promotes fibroblast activity and stimulates extracellular matrix (ECM) production for structural skin renewal.
  • 3 Matrix Organization: Supports the synthesis of collagen, elastin, and glycosaminoglycans (GAG) to restore dermal density, firmness, and elasticity.

Precautions & Safety Notes
Contraindications Contraindicated during pregnancy or breastfeeding, in the presence of active skin infection at the injection site, or in patients with known hypersensitivity to any listed ingredient.
Safety Warnings For use by licensed medical and aesthetic professionals only.
Common Temporary Side Effects
Localized redness, swelling, or bruising at the injection sites may occur and are typically transient.
Post-Treatment Care
  • 1 Avoid direct sun exposure for a short period following treatment.
  • 2 Avoid saunas and intense heat for a short period following treatment.
  • 3 Avoid vigorous massage of the treated area immediately after the procedure.
